Transaction 63c5e9988a8f058f9bf292156065e39b13e277a55ec206e8d68a7590d8ca518c
1 Input
1 Output
-
63c5e9988a8f058f9bf292156065e39b13e277a55ec206e8d68a7590d8ca518c:0
- value
- 2295762
- script pubkey
- OP_0 OP_PUSHBYTES_20 ff883d3ca09e26399ad10f583eaad0db71bbf7d3
- address
- bc1ql7yr609qncnrnxk3pavra2ksmdcmha7n7xl7dz